Transaction 245266fca46545d44c0660018e5e8b588626452168c191f72e927000919b6891
2 Input
2 Outputs
- 245266fca46545d44c0660018e5e8b588626452168c191f72e927000919b6891:0
- 245266fca46545d44c0660018e5e8b588626452168c191f72e927000919b6891:1
value 100000
address 1QJKQu2DCieNU5xPGrFACgGbdn8HTxnHyd
value 90966
address 132rgWMKBcYtqvwKZMggKnSVTsUpy3h8nU